Ethylene oxide (EtO) is a gas that is produced in large volumes at some chemical manufacturing facilities. It is used to make other chemicals that are then used to make a range of common products, including antifreeze, plastics, detergents, and adhesives. The Environmental Protection Agency today proposed requiring commercial sterilization facilities to comply within 18 months with stricter emission and control standards for ethylene oxide (EtO), a type of gas used to sterilize certain medical devices that cannot be sterilized using alternative methods.
